NICOSIA – Greek Foreign Minister Nikos Dendias on Tuesday spoke on the phone with his Cypriot counterpart Ioannis Kasoulides in the context of the close and continuous coordination between Greece and Cyprus.
The two top officials reviewed and assessed the latest developments in the Eastern Mediterranean, in Libya and the Cyprus issue, the Greek foreign ministry posted on Twitter.
